Effects of dietary carnitine inclusion on the growth and flesh quality of hybrid tilapia.Dietary carnitine supplementation was found to improve growth in several fishspecies, and also been shown that dietary carnitine supplements reduced the lipidcontent of liver and muscle in several species. By contrast, dietary carnitinesupplementation did not affect growth performance in salmonids, nor did it reduce bodylipid content in several species. This study is conducted to investigate the effect of dietarycarnitine supplementation on the growth and body lipid distribution of hybrid tilapia.4. The effect of feed additive on growth performance and body lipid distribution of silverperch.The use of low fish meal and high energy diets is a current practice in theaquaculture industry, as these diets have been considered beneficial for economic andnutritional reasons. However, such diet with high levels of alternative plan proteinsand/or non-protein energy supply (particularly through fats) is generally associated withan increase in whole-body lipids. Increasing awareness exists of the effects of such highcaloric intake on the quality of fish products as human food, because the localization,quantitative importance and composition of body fat deposits may affect their dieteticvalue, organoleptic properties, transformation yield and storage stability. The ami of thisstudy is conducted to elucidate the effect of dietary carnitine on the growth performanceand body lipid distribution of silver perch.5.
